Technical Specifications
Fuel Petrol Petrol
Engine Displacement 853.00 cc 803.00 cc
Engine Water-cooled 4-stroke in-line two-cylinder engine, four valves per cylinder, two overhead camshafts L-Twin cylinder, 2 valve per cylinder Desmodromic, air cooled
Engine Starting Electric start Self start
Engine Lubrication Dry Sump Lubrication --
Clutch Multiple-disc wet clutch (anti hopping), mechanically operated --
Fuel System Electronic Injection --
Ignition Electronic injection --
Cooling System Liquid-Cooled --
Maximum Power 77 hp @ 7500 rpm 64kW @ 8250 rpm
Maximum Torque 83 Nm @ 6000 rpm 78 Nm @ 6250 rpm
Transmission Constant mesh 6-speed gearbox integrated in crankcase 6 speed
Gear Shift Pattern 1-N-2-3-4-5-6 --
Top Speed 190 km/h kmph 210 kmph
Battery 12 V / 10 Ah, maintenance-free --
Frame Tubular steel space frame, load bearing engine --
Taillamp LED --
Mileage
Standard Test Conditions -- 13 kmpl
Overall Mileage 24.39 kmpl --
Tyres
Front 110/80 R19 120/60 ZR 17 Pirelli Angel ST
Rear 150/70 R17 160/60 ZR 17 Pirelli Angel ST
Wheel / RIM Cast aluminium wheels --
Brakes
Front Dual floating disc brakes, dual-piston floating calipers 2 x 320mm discs, 4-piston radial calliper with ABS
Rear 265 mm Single disc brake, single-piston floating caliper 245mm disc, 2-piston calliper
Suspension
Front 41 mm Telescopic fork Marzocchi 43mm upside-down forks
Rear Cast aluminium dual swing arm, central spring strut, spring pre-load hydraulically adjustable, rebound damping adjustable Double sides swingarm
Colors Available
Colors Light White, Austin Yellow Metallic and Pollux Metallic Matt Diamond Black Silk, Red.


Physical Specs
Length 2255 mm 2100 mm
Width 922 mm 780 mm
Height 1225 mm 1060 mm
Weight 224 kg 187 kg
Wheelbase 1559 mm 1450 mm m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 15 litres 15 litres
